   
/* Grundelemente */
body {margin-left: 0px;margin-top: 0px;padding: 0;font-family: Verdana, Arial, Helvetica, sans-serif;background-color: #ffffff;color: #000;}



div.gallery img {border-color: #9497A6; border-style: solid; border-width: 1px;
padding: 2px;
}

.querformat-rechts {
float: right;
width: 230px;
font-size: 0.6em;
color: #14152A;
line-height: 1.37em;
margin: 0px 0px 0px 20px;
}

.querformat-links {
float: left;
width: 230px;
font-size: 0.6em;
color: #14152A;
line-height: 1.37em;
}

.hochformat-rechts {
float: right;
width: 135px;
font-size: 0.6em;
color: #14152A;
line-height: 1.37em;
}

.hochformat-links {
float: left;
width: 135px;
font-size: 0.6em;
color: #14152A;
line-height: 1.37em;
}

.teaser-bild {
	padding: 0em 1em 0.6em 0em;
}

.teaser-bild-b {
	padding: 1em 0em 1.5em 0em;
	font-size: 0.6em;
color: #14152A;
line-height: 1.37em;
}

span.text {font-size: 12px;line-height: 18px;color: #323232; background-color: #fff;}

span.text a {
	color:#14152A;
	text-decoration:none;
}

.ppw-galleryHeadline {
	color:#333333;	
}

.ppw-galleryHeadline a{
	color:#660000;
	text-decoration:none;	
}

.ppw-galleryHeadline a:hover{
	text-decoration:underline;	
}


#rahmen-aussen {margin-right:auto;margin-left:auto;margin-top: 0px;position: relative;width: 790px;}
h1 {color: #c50023;font-size: 18px;font-weight: bold;margin: 6px;}
.ueberschrift{
	float: left;
	padding:34px 0px 10px 32px;
	width: 480px;
	height: 30px;
}
.logo{float: left;padding:8px 0px 0px 30px;}
.linieoben{margin:0px 0px 0px 32px;background-image: url(images/galerie_linieoben.gif);background-repeat: repeat-x;width: 730px;}
div.text {font-size: 11px;line-height: 18px;color: #000;padding:0px 80px 40px 80px;
height: 34px;}
.neuer-abschnitt {clear: both;margin:0px;}
#bildrahmen {padding:12px 0px 0px 0px;background-image: url(images/galerie_hintergrund.gif);text-align: center;}
#text-unterschrift {font-size: 10px;color: #838383;padding:12px 0px 12px 0px;}
.linieunten{margin:0px 0px 0px 32px;background-image: url(images/galerie_linieunten.gif);background-repeat: repeat-x;width: 730px;}

.nav-zahlen {width:100%;text-align: center;}
.nav-zahlen a {
	padding:1px;
	text-decoration:none;
	font-weight: bold;
	font-size: 12px;
}

.nav-zahlen a:hover {
	text-decoration:underline;
	background:#f6d8dd;
	color:#333333;
}

.rot {color: #c50023;}
.schwarz {color: #000;}
nav-zahlen .fett {font-weight: bold;}

.active {
	background:#d5d5d5;
	color:#333333;
	padding:2px;
	border:1px solid #AAA;
	font-weight: bold;
	font-family:  Helvetica,Verdana,sans-serif;
	font-size: 18px;
	text-decoration:underline;
}


div.tx-ppwimageway-pi1 img {
	border-color: #9497A6; 
	border-style: solid; 
	border-width: 1px;
	padding: 2px;
	margin:2px;
}


div.tx-ppwimageway-pi1 {
	color:#000E56;
	font-family:Verdana,Arial,Helvetica,sans-serif;
	font-size:12px;
	font-weight:normal;
	line-height:16px;
}



